[QUOTE="sabrinathecat, post: 6134180, member: 89838"] A large portion of it is the fact that the touch screen is hyper-sensitive, and there is little to no fine control. Then, to add an attachment to an email, you have to touch and hold down, hoping that you are in the right place, and then the pop-up shows up, and maybe you hit the correct sub-menu button. Is having a paper-clip icon so difficult? Then there are all the "helpful" assistants that keep distorting my work. Oh, and when it thinks I know what I want, and is correct, how do I get the damn thing to actually insert the word it is suggesting? Don't know. Tried everything logical (like tapping on the pop-up), but all it does is move the cursor to the now-wrong place. New message is a pop-up submenu instead of just a button? How about labeling buttons and icons so that their function is obvious and/or clear? That also seems to be a problem. It seems like the system is trying to do too much, without remembering to let the user just work. And some of the functions... it's like the old joke-of-an-interface about throwing the disk icon into the trash in order to eject it. Who thought that was a good idea? [/QUOTE]
